1. Introduction
This manual provides instructions for the proper use and care of your Sony MVC-FD87 Digital Camera. The MVC-FD87 is designed for ease of use, capturing images directly onto standard 3.5-inch floppy disks for simple transfer to a computer. It features a 1.3-megapixel sensor and a 3x optical zoom lens.

2. Setup
2.1 Battery Installation
- Ensure the camera is powered off.
- Locate the battery compartment cover, typically on the bottom or side of the camera.
- Open the cover and insert the Sony InfoLithium NP-F330 battery, aligning it with the polarity indicators.
- Close the battery compartment cover securely.
- Connect the power cable to charge the battery before first use.
2.2 Floppy Disk Insertion
- Locate the floppy disk drive slot on the camera.
- Insert a standard 3.5-inch 2HD floppy disk with the metal shutter facing forward and the label side up.
- Push the disk gently until it clicks into place.
2.3 Powering On
Press the power button, usually located near the top or back of the camera, to turn on the device. The LCD screen will illuminate.
3. Operating Instructions
3.1 Taking Photographs
- Framing Your Shot: Use the LCD screen or viewfinder to compose your image.
- Zoom Adjustment: Use the zoom lever (often labeled 'W' for Wide and 'T' for Telephoto) to adjust the 3x optical zoom and 6x digital zoom.
- Focusing: The camera features autofocus. Half-press the shutter button to allow the camera to focus. A focus indicator will confirm when the subject is in focus.
- Capturing the Image: Fully press the shutter button to take the picture. The image will be saved to the inserted floppy disk.
3.2 Flash Modes
The built-in flash offers several modes:
- Auto Flash: The camera automatically determines if flash is needed.
- Red-Eye Reduction: Emits a pre-flash to minimize red-eye effect.
- Fill Flash: Forces the flash to fire, useful for brightening shadows in bright conditions.
Select the desired flash mode using the dedicated flash button or through the camera's menu system.
3.3 Transferring Images to a Computer
The Sony MVC-FD87 records images directly to 3.5-inch floppy disks. To transfer images:
- Eject the floppy disk from the camera.
- Insert the floppy disk into a compatible 3.5-inch floppy disk drive on your computer (Mac or PC).
- Access the images directly from the floppy disk drive, typically appearing as a removable drive.
- Copy the image files (JPEG format) to your computer's hard drive.
MGI software is provided for image manipulation on both Mac and PC platforms, enhancing your ability to edit and manage your photos.
4. Maintenance
4.1 Cleaning the Camera
- Lens: Use a soft, lint-free cloth specifically designed for camera lenses. Gently wipe the lens surface to remove dust or smudges. Avoid using harsh chemicals.
- Body: Wipe the camera body with a dry, soft cloth. For stubborn dirt, slightly dampen the cloth with water.
- LCD Screen: Use a soft, dry cloth to clean the LCD screen.
4.2 Battery Care
- Charge the InfoLithium NP-F330 battery fully before first use and whenever the battery indicator is low.
- Store the battery in a cool, dry place when not in use.
- Avoid exposing the battery to extreme temperatures.
4.3 Storage
When storing the camera for extended periods, remove the battery and floppy disk. Store the camera in a dry, dust-free environment, preferably in a camera bag or protective case.
5. Troubleshooting
| Problem | Possible Cause | Solution |
|---|---|---|
| Camera does not power on. | Battery is depleted or incorrectly inserted. | Charge the battery or re-insert it correctly. Ensure the battery compartment is closed. |
| Images are blurry. | Camera shake, subject too close, or focus issue. | Hold the camera steady. Ensure the subject is within the camera's focusing range. Allow the autofocus to lock before fully pressing the shutter. |
| Cannot save images to floppy disk. | Floppy disk is full, write-protected, or faulty. | Insert a new floppy disk. Check if the write-protect tab on the disk is in the unlocked position. Try a different floppy disk. |
| Flash does not fire. | Flash mode is set to 'Off' or battery is low. | Check flash settings and ensure it's set to Auto, Fill, or Red-Eye Reduction. Charge the battery. |
